Description
Following a reflective introduction, the angular aspect of this contemporary work ensues. The percussion contribution to establish the pulse and drive with varied textures will make this work sparkle. Dramatic and bold this is an exciting addition to the contemporary literature affording opportunity for all sections to shine. A truly exciting choice! About the Composer: Roland Barrett

Roland Barrett

Roland Barrett has shaped composition pedagogy and practice at the University of Oklahoma since 2001, where he teaches music theory and composition across undergraduate and graduate levels with particular emphasis on twentieth-century techniques. Before joining the faculty, he spent fifteen years as Assistant Director of Bands, a background that informs his deep understanding of ensemble writing and performance.

What to expect

The piece unfolds with geometric precision and modern sensibility. After an introspective beginning that draws listeners in, angular rhythms and textures take over, creating a propulsive energy that feels both edgy and carefully controlled, with percussion colors adding sparkle and depth.

Who it's for

Grade 3 concert bands ready to engage with contemporary language and ensemble balance. Directors seeking material that challenges all sections equally and rewards careful preparation will find a confident choice here.

How to get the most out of it

  • Balance the reflective opening carefully; allow silence and space to establish the contemplative mood before the angular material enters with full intensity.
  • Emphasize the percussion section's role as rhythmic architects. Their varied textures and pulse-driving responsibility demand independent rehearsal and precise coordination with the winds.
  • Shape the dramatic sections with clear dynamic contrasts. This work's boldness comes from intentional peaks and valleys, not relentless fortissimo playing.

How to use it

Program this alongside traditional repertoire to showcase your band's contemporary fluency, or place it as a concert finale where its dramatic arc and decisive ending leave a strong closing impression. At six minutes, it pairs well with shorter classical selections and works effectively in festival settings.

Skills your students will build

  • Reading and executing contemporary rhythmic figures and meters
  • Balancing tone quality across independent melodic lines in non-traditional voicings
  • Responding to percussion-driven pulse and texture cues
  • Dynamic shaping in works without traditional harmonic progressions
  • Sustained focus during reflective and dramatic contrasts
